Understanding the Impact of Brain Injuries
Brain injuries are not always obvious. While some may result in immediate loss of consciousness or visible physical trauma, others can manifest in more subtle ways, such as:
- Memory problems
- Difficulty concentrating
- Mood swings
- Headaches
- Sleep disturbances
- Cognitive impairment
These symptoms can significantly impact a person’s ability to function in daily life and may require extensive medical treatment and rehabilitation. The costs associated with brain injury care can be staggering, often placing a tremendous financial burden on families.

What to Do After a Brain Injury
If you suspect that you or a loved one has suffered a brain injury, it’s crucial to take the following steps:
- Seek Medical Attention: The first and most important step is to seek immediate medical attention. A doctor can evaluate your condition, diagnose any injuries, and recommend the appropriate treatment.
- Document Everything: Keep detailed records of all medical treatments, expenses, and lost wages. This information will be essential in building your case.
- Consult with a Brain Injury Lawyer: Contact a qualified brain injury lawyer as soon as possible to discuss your legal options. A lawyer can advise you on your rights and help you take the necessary steps to protect your claim.
- Avoid Talking to Insurance Companies: Insurance companies may try to contact you soon after the injury to get a statement. It’s best to avoid talking to them until you have consulted with a lawyer. Anything you say could be used against you later in the case.
- Gather Evidence: If possible, gather any evidence related to the injury, such as photos of the accident scene, witness statements, and police reports.
- Focus on Recovery: Brain injuries can be devastating and the recovery journey can be quite tedious and long. Make sure you focus on your recovery and follow the instructions from your doctors. A brain injury lawyer will handle all the legal details so you can focus on getting your life back.

The Role of a Brain Injury Lawyer in Proving Negligence
To win a brain injury case, your lawyer must prove that the other party was negligent and that their negligence caused your injuries. Negligence is a legal term that means the person or entity failed to exercise reasonable care, resulting in harm to another person.
To prove negligence, your brain injury lawyer will need to gather evidence to establish the following elements:
- Duty of Care: The other party owed you a duty of care to act reasonably and avoid causing harm.
- Breach of Duty: The other party breached their duty of care by acting negligently.
- Causation: The other party’s negligence directly caused your brain injury.
- Damages: You suffered damages as a result of your brain injury, such as med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
Your brain injury lawyer will use a variety of tools to gather evidence, including:
- Police reports
- Witness statements
- Medical records
- Expert testimony
- Accident reconstruction
Understanding the Long-Term Effects of Brain Injuries
Brain injuries can have a wide range of long-term effects, both physical and cognitive. These effects can significantly impact a person’s ability to work, maintain relationships, and participate in daily activities.
Some of the common long-term effects of brain injuries include:
- Cognitive impairment (problems with memory, attention, and executive function)
- Physical disabilities (such as weakness, paralysis, and coordination problems)
- Emotional and behavioral changes (such as depression, anxiety, and irritability)
- Communication difficulties (such as problems with speaking, reading, and writing)
- Seizures
- Chronic pain
